The Challenge
As populations age, millions of older adults live with incontinence – a common, manageable condition that is still surrounded by silence, shame, and loss of dignity. Rather than being treated as a normal part of ageing or health, it is often experienced as something to hide.
"Dignity is compromised when products signal frailty rather than normality."
- Many options feel clinical, bulky, infantilising, or stigmatising.
- Discomfort impacts confidence, leading to social withdrawal.
- Families and caregivers are under-supported.
- Care is often framed as dependency rather than autonomy.
